Friederike Otto
Friederike (Fredi) Otto is Professor of Climate Science at Imperial College London and former Director of the Environmental Change Institute at Oxford. She has written for the Guardian and New Scientist, and her work has been covered from The Times, Financial Times, and Telegraph to The New York Times, Wall Street Journal, and Washington Post. A regular commentator on broadcast news, she has spoken at major public events including the Hay Festival and New Scientist Live. She is the author of two bestselling books: Angry Weather and Climate Injustice – the latter a #1 bestseller in Germany – which explore the science and societal impacts of climate change. Fredi was named one of TIME magazine’s 100 Most Influential People in the World in 2021 for co-founding and leading World Weather Attribution.
